Transaction 76da639172ade80afc580090ce4bf141c71b575e088fec474963efb70c8443c9
2 Input
2 Outputs
- 76da639172ade80afc580090ce4bf141c71b575e088fec474963efb70c8443c9:0
- 76da639172ade80afc580090ce4bf141c71b575e088fec474963efb70c8443c9:1
value 6425071
address 34p8SsMbJzS48hkwEucdj6kEnZ2hiRX6Gv
value 495644
address 1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f